|
微信小程序设计### 微信小程序搭建全攻略 在移动互联网时代,微信小程序以其无需下载安装、即用即走的特点,迅速成为连接用户与服务的重要桥梁。无论是电商、餐饮、教育还是娱乐行业,微信小程序都展现出了巨大的商业价值。本文将详细介绍如何从零开始搭建一个微信小程序,帮助初学者快速上手。 #### 一、准备工作 1. **注册微信小程序账号**: - 前往[微信公众平台](https://mp.weixin.qq.com/),点击右上角的“立即注册”,选择“小程序”类别进行注册。 - 填写相关信息,包括邮箱、密码、验证码等,并完成邮箱验证。 - 选择主体类型(个人、企业、政府、媒体等),提交相应的资质证明。 - 支付300元认证费用(企业类型可通过公众号资质复用免去此费用)。 2. **安装开发工具**: - 下载并安装[微信开发者工具](https://developers.weixin.qq.com/miniprogram/dev/devtools/download.html),这是官方提供的一站式开发、调试、预览和发布小程序的集成环境。 #### 二、创建项目 1. **登录微信开发者工具**: - 使用注册的小程序账号登录微信开发者工具。 2. **新建项目**: - 点击“+”号新建项目,填写AppID(注册成功后获得)、项目名称、项目目录等信息。 - 选择“建立一个小程序示例”可以快速生成一个包含基础页面和功能的项目模板。 #### 三、项目结构与基础配置 1. **项目结构**: - `app.js`:小程序的逻辑文件,用于定义全局变量、生命周期函数等。 - `app.json`:小程序的公共配置文件,包括页面路径、窗口表现、底部导航栏等。 - `app.wxss`:小程序的公共样式文件,用于定义全局样式。 - `pages/`文件夹:存放各个页面的文件,每个页面包含`.js`(逻辑)、`.json`(配置)、`.wxml`(结构)、`.wxss`(样式)四个文件。 2. **基础配置**: - 在`app.json`中配置页面路径,如: ```json { "pages": [ "pages/index/index", "pages/logs/logs" ], "window": { "navigationBarTitleText": "Demo" } } ``` #### 四、开发页面与功能 1. **创建新页面**: - 在`pages/`文件夹下新建文件夹和对应的四个文件,如`pages/about/about.js`、`pages/about/about.json`等。 - 在`app.json`的`pages`数组中添加新页面的路径。 2. **编写页面逻辑**: - 在`.js`文件中编写页面的数据绑定、事件处理等逻辑。 - 使用`setData`方法更新页面数据。 3. **设计页面布局**: - 在`.wxml`文件中使用微信小程序的组件标签设计页面结构。 - 如使用` 标题:微信小程序设计:创新、便捷与用户体验的深度融合 在移动互联网的浪潮中,微信小程序以其轻量级、无需下载安装、即用即走的特性,迅速成为连接用户与服务的重要桥梁。微信小程序设计,作为这一新兴应用形态的核心,不仅关乎技术实现,更在于如何通过创新设计思维,将便捷性与用户体验完美融合,创造出既满足用户需求又富有吸引力的数字产品。 ### 一、微信小程序设计的核心原则 1. **轻量化与高效性**:微信小程序的核心优势在于其轻量级,设计时应尽量减少资源占用,确保快速加载和运行。这要求开发者在功能规划、界面布局、图片资源等方面进行优化,确保用户能够在最短时间内获得所需服务。 2. **用户为中心**:优秀的小程序设计始终围绕用户需求展开,通过深入调研了解目标用户群体的行为习惯、偏好及痛点,以此为基础设计功能流程和交互界面,提升用户体验的满意度和忠诚度。 3. **一致性与品牌识别**:保持界面设计的一致性是提升用户体验的关键。微信小程序应遵循统一的视觉风格、色彩搭配、图标设计及交互模式,同时融入品牌元素,增强品牌识别度,使用户在不同场景下也能迅速识别并信任该小程序。 ### 二、创新设计策略 1. **场景化设计**:微信小程序应紧密结合用户的生活场景,如餐饮、购物、出行、教育等,通过场景化设计,将服务无缝融入用户的日常活动中,提升服务的实用性和粘性。 2. **智能化与个性化**:利用AI技术,如自然语言处理、机器学习等,实现小程序的智能化推荐和服务,根据用户的偏好和历史行为,提供个性化的内容和服务,增强用户体验的定制化感受。 3. **社交属性强化**:微信小程序依托微信强大的社交生态,可以通过分享、点赞、评论等社交功能,增加用户之间的互动,形成口碑传播,扩大小程序的影响力。 ### 三、用户体验优化实践 1. **简化操作流程**:减少用户操作步骤,优化流程设计,确保用户能够以最少的点击次数完成任务,提升使用效率。 2. **清晰的信息架构**:构建直观的信息架构,确保用户能够快速找到所需信息或服务,避免信息过载导致的困扰。 3. **反馈机制完善**:为用户提供即时的操作反馈,无论是加载状态、操作成功还是错误提示,都应清晰明了,增强用户的控制感和信任感。 4. **无障碍设计**:关注特殊用户群体的需求,如视觉障碍者、老年人等,通过字体大小调整、语音导航等功能,确保小程序对所有用户友好。 ### 四、结语 微信小程序设计是一个不断探索与实践的过程,它要求开发者不仅要掌握最新的技术趋势,更要具备深刻的用户洞察力和创新思维。通过不断优化设计,将便捷性、创新性与用户体验深度融合,微信小程序将成为连接线上线下、促进产业升级的重要力量,为用户带来更加丰富、便捷、个性化的服务体验。未来,随着技术的不断进步和用户需求的变化,微信小程序设计将持续进化,开启更多可能。 |